8 Disposable Appliance Bag and Method of Use Thereof US11965219 2007-12-27 US20090169136A1 2009-07-02 Glenn Kenney
A water heater bag and the method of using the bag to dispose of the water heater are disclosed herein. The bag is comprised of a rectangular bottom, the rectangular bottom adapted to identify for the user the position or the bag for the most proper and easiest installation. One or more sidewalls are integrated to the bottom, extending away from the bottom at a generally perpendicular angle at full bag extension. Each top portion of the one or more sidewalls is adapted to extend beyond the top end of an inserted water heater, so the bags length is greater than the length of the water heaters it carries, or 90 inches. These top portions have an upper end opening adapted to receive the water heater and are adapted to fold and be punctured by at least one water port. The material used in constructing the bag is comprised of a disposable material having a thickness of about 2 mils.
9 Water heater made of pressure-resistant plastic material US09603404 2000-06-26 US06266484B1 2001-07-24 Ruggero Marchetti
A water heater made of plastic material comprises an external case (7) and a main body (2) including two semi-shells (2a,2b) soldered to create a body which can withstand temperature and pressure. The two semi-shells (2a, 2b), each of which is fitted with radial reinforcing elements (8) and the external case (7), are made of compatible and recyclable thermoplastic materials, in particular mixtures of polymers reinforced with glass fibers, preferably in a percentage equal to or higher than 30%.

17 오일샌드 회수용 보일러 공급수 생산장치 KR1020080084330 2008-08-28 KR1020100025682A 2010-03-10 배위섭; 강경석
PURPOSE: An apparatus for producing feed water of a boiler for recovering oil sand is provided to manufacture the feed water of high purity by using an evaporation method and an electric purification method. CONSTITUTION: An apparatus for producing feed water of a boiler for recovering oil sand comprises an oil water separator(10), a desalter(20), an evaporator(30), and a steam generator(40). The oil water separator divides the oil and water from the product water produced from an oil sand layer(1) through the oil treatment process. The desalter desalts supplementing water provided from the surface water or the subsurface water. The evaporator evaporates the desalted water from produced water, separated from the oil water separator and desalter. The steam generator generates and supplies steam by heating the produced water and the desalted water.

19 열교환 기능과 연소기능이 일체화된 공해물질 저감형보일러 KR1020070015861 2007-02-15 KR100807057B1 2008-02-25 이창언; 이현용
A boiler for reducing pollutants combined with combustion and heat exchange is provided to enhance performance of the boiler by delaying combustion gas and increasing a heat-transferring area by arranging vertical and horizontal plates in the boiler. A boiler for reducing pollutants combined with combustion and heat exchange includes a body(32), a combustion gas guide groove(38), a pipe(48), supplying nozzles(50), and an ignition member(52). A combustion room(34) is formed at one side of the body and a combustion gas exhaust hole(36) is formed at the other side of the body. The combustion gas guide groove is formed along an inner peripheral surface of the combustion room to circularly exhaust combustion gas. The pipe is formed inside a wall surface(46) of the body to longitudinally move heating water along the body. The supplying nozzles are coupled with an upper end of the body to be connected to the combustion room and injects a mixture of fuel and air from a side of the combustion room. The ignition member is coupled with an upper surface of the body to be connected to the combustion room.
